On April 27, 2023, a Jilin University delegation visited the FinU, as part of which agreements on cooperation and the implementation of an academic exchange program between universities were signed.

The guests were welcomed by the Vice-Rector for Educational and Methodological Work of the FinU, Doctor of Economics, Professor Ekaterina Kameneva. In her introductory speech, she talked about the history and main activities of the FinU.

Ekaterina Kameneva stressed that the visit of the Jilin University delegation is significant under Russian-Chinese cooperation in science and education and added that FinU pays great attention to interaction and the formation of ties with universities in China.

In turn, the Permanent Vice-Rector of Jilin University, Weitao Zheng, noted the importance of forming partnerships in the educational sphere and expressed readiness to provide comprehensive support to new joint projects, noting that cooperation with Russia is a priority area of China's international cooperation.

During the visit, the parties discussed the possibilities of implementing joint educational programs, academic exchange programs, scientific and technical projects, organizing and holding scientific and practical conferences, and preparing joint publications of Chinese and Russian scientists.

On behalf of the FinU, representatives of the International Cooperation Department and the Faculty of International Economic Relations took part in the meeting.

During the second part of the visit, negotiations were held between the leadership of the Institute of Northeast Asia of Jilin University and the Faculty of International Economic Relations of the FinU, as part of which the organizational bases of the implementation of the joint educational double-degree program on the basis of the program “Global Economics and International Trade” (with in-depth study of the Chinese economy and Chinese language) of the Faculty of International Economic Relations and the program “National and Regional Economics” with the profile “Russian language and Economy of Russia” of the Institute of Northeast Asia and joint summer schools in Russian and Chinese.

After the negotiations, representatives of Jilin University visited the Chinese office of the Faculty of International Relations, participated in a Chinese language class and visited the FinU Museum.

The parties expressed confidence that the signing of the agreement and the launch of joint projects will contribute to the further development of multifaceted cooperation between universities.
